
Night scenes of a distant and silent Havana. Anonymous voices tell us about places they would like to visit and come back, places they would like to know and never forget. They tell us about the transition moment in which they coexist, a state sketched in the traveler as a building facade cut by the light of the street lamps at night. Impressions of Andrea Novoa’s state of trance, a flaneur, who experiences the mental space that appears when crossing corners and streets of a foreign city, suspended in the time.
